Red tide is one of environmental problems which are regarded recently. Many valuable conclusions are achieved, which are about mechanism of its occurrence, prediction, simulation and toxicology, etc. Essentially, red tide is an ecological phenomenon leaded by bad environment.Phytoplankton is the key study object in this paper. Nonlinear dynamics of phytoplankton's spatio-temporal distribution is studied under applied mathematics. By numerical experiments, the relation between it and red tide is discovered. Under hydraulics of Pearl River Estuary, equilibrium point and concentration of phytoplankton under the whole effect of factors is simulated. In the end of the paper, equilibrium point of phytoplankton can be a key predicted exponent for red tide breaking out is suggested. All these conclusions are the bases of advancing red tide forecast's time and precision.The main works in this paper are as follows:1. The qualitative analysis of phytoplankton ecological model under different factors is carried. And nonlinear characters of phytoplankton are studied;2. The functions of biological factors and chemical factors on ecological actions of phytoplankton are studied by numerical simulation method;3. One-dimension and two-dimension simulations on 3-component ecological model are worked for studying spatio-temporal distribution of phytoplankton and chaos;4. Hydrodynamics of estuary is simulated on the base of two-dimensional shallow water equations.5. By coupling the nutrient model with phytoplankton growth model, nutrient-phytoplankton-zooplankton ecological model is established. Under hydraulics conditions of Pearl River Estuary, the relation of the occurrence of red tide and the rule of ecological actions of phytoplankton, the relation of the spacial development of red tide and that of phytoplankton and the relation between the equilibrium point development and concentration are studied. Equilibrium point of phytoplankton can be a key predicted exponent for red tide breaking out is proved.
